This PR updates the lyft CNI to the latest version, which:

  • Use the AWS API to retrieve instance network limits. This mean we can know use any instance type.
  • Add IP allocation batching

Marked as WIP because we want to test it first.
As @gjtempleton said, we tested it and it's working as expected.
